Address

MNW4XSBs73FiN3nzCpuj11zWo75WafC1KD

0 MONA

Confirmed
Total Received0.10396374 MONA
Total Sent0.10396374 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MNW4XSBs73FiN3nzCpuj11zWo75WafC1KD0.10396374 MONA
 
 
MNW4XSBs73FiN3nzCpuj11zWo75WafC1KD0.10396374 MONA